Kinaxis appoints Bell CPO, Paterson COO, Pate CHRO

2023-08-03 15:04 ET - News Release

Mr. John Sicard reports

KINAXIS ENHANCES EXECUTIVE LEADERSHIP TO CONTINUE COMPANY GROWTH

Kinaxis Inc. has appointed three new C-suite leaders -- all promoted from within Kinaxis -- in product, operations and human resources, effective immediately. These new executives were put in place to continue the company's ambitious growth goals as Kinaxis continues to set the agenda for supply chain management.

New chief product officer Andrew Bell will report to president and chief executive officer John Sicard, overseeing the company's engineering, development and product management teams, as well as the company's continued investment in AI (artificial intelligence) and machine learning where Kinaxis has more than 50 issued and pending patents. Mr. Bell has been with Kinaxis for more than a decade, most recently leading product management. He previously held roles at Nokia Group (then Alcatel-Lucent).

Mr. Bell commented, "I'm looking forward to expanding our product footprint, continuing to invest in AI and driving continuous innovation on top of our foundation of excellence in supply chain -- it's a real honour to lead this team."

As Kinaxis continues its global scale, Mr. Sicard introduced a new chief operating officer role, appointing Megan Paterson, the company's former chief human resources officer. Ms. Paterson will have responsibility over the company's cloud services operations, corporate IT, corporate strategy, HR and global real estate. In this new role, Ms. Paterson will create centres of excellence that empower the company to operate with agility and alignment as it continues to expand its footprint globally.

"Our growth and success are predicated on building agility and consistency across our work force so that we can enjoy continued accelerated growth. I'm thrilled to be taking on this new role," Ms. Paterson said.

With Ms. Paterson's new role, Kinaxis named Amber Pate, former vice-president of human resources, to chief human resources officer (CHRO). A former CHRO, Ms. Pate was overseeing the talent management, compensation and total rewards, and will leverage this experience to take on the entire global HR remit as CHRO.

These appointments come on the heels of the company's announcement of its new chief marketing officer, Margaret Franco.

Mr. Sicard commented: "There is a huge opportunity to deliver real supply chain transformation for companies around the world. Our advanced technology and unique methodology make us leaders in this space, and I'm thrilled to promote Andrew, Megan and Amber into these new roles as we scale to support our growing global customer base."

Headquartered in Ottawa, Kinaxis works with many of the largest global brands, including Bose, Carlsberg, Ford, HAVI, Honeywell, Merck, Procter & Gamble, Schneider Electric, Qualcomm, Unilever, and many others. Since its IPO (initial public offering) in 2014, the company has more than tripled revenue, and in May, 2023, Kinaxis was named a leader in Gartner's Magic Quadrant for Supply Chain Planning Solutions for the ninth consecutive time.
